What is an Intensive Outpatient Program (IOP)?

An Intensive Outpatient Program is a level of care designed for individuals who need more support than standard outpatient services but do not require the around-the-clock supervision of inpatient treatment. IOPs offer a comprehensive approach to treatment that allows individuals to continue living at home while participating in structured therapy sessions.

 

Key Benefits of an IOP -

  1. Flexibility and Convenience: One of the major advantages of an Intensive Outpatient Program in New York City is its flexibility. Participants can attend therapy sessions during the day or evening, making it easier to fit treatment into their work or personal schedules. This flexibility helps individuals maintain their daily responsibilities while focusing on recovery.
  2. Structured Support: IOPs provide a structured schedule of therapy sessions, including individual counseling, group therapy, and educational workshops. This structure ensures that participants receive consistent support and intervention while learning coping strategies and tools for managing their conditions.
  3. Community and Peer Support: In a bustling city like New York, connecting with others who are going through similar challenges can be incredibly valuable. Intensive Outpatient Programs foster a sense of community through group therapy and support sessions, helping individuals build a network of peers who understand their experiences.
  4. Professional Guidance: Intensive Outpatient Programs in New York City are typically led by a team of licensed professionals, including therapists, counselors, and medical staff. These experts provide evidence-based treatment and personalized care plans tailored to each individual’s needs, ensuring a high level of professional support.
  5. Cost-Effective Option: Compared to inpatient programs, IOPs are often more affordable while still offering intensive care. This makes them a viable option for those seeking comprehensive treatment without the financial burden of residential programs.
